Regulations, Laws and Maximum Pension Benefits

Registered Pension plan is a form of a trust that provides pension benefits for an employee of a company upon retirement. RPPs are registered with the government. The employee and employer, or just the employer make contributions to this retirement plan until the employee leaves the company or retires.

Assets and Liabilities of Registered Pension Plan

Every three years, registered pension plan requires to have actuarial evaluation by independent actuary company, because it is important to test the plan solvency and to adjust the contribution levels required to meet future liabilities.
